EXCEEDS logo
Exceeds
XiangCany

PROFILE

Xiangcany

Worked on the go-vikunja/vikunja repository to enhance the reliability of local file storage by addressing a critical bug affecting directory initialization. Focused on backend development using Go, the work involved implementing defensive checks to ensure the base directory for file storage exists before any write operations occur. This approach improved error handling and file handling processes, reducing the risk of write-time failures and data integrity issues when storage directories are missing. The update led to more predictable user workflows and fewer support incidents related to storage setup, with changes prepared for quality assurance, review, and deployment within the project.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
25
Activity Months1

Work History

January 2026

1 Commits

Jan 1, 2026

January 2026 (2026-01) focused on stabilizing local file storage reliability in the go-vikunja/vikunja project. Delivered a critical bug fix that ensures the base directory for local file storage exists before attempting writes, improving error handling and robustness of file operations. This change reduces write-time failures in production and mitigates data integrity risks when storage directories are missing, resulting in more predictable user workflows and fewer support incidents related to storage setup.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Go

Technical Skills

backend developmenterror handlingfile handling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

go-vikunja/vikunja

Jan 2026 Jan 2026
1 Month active

Languages Used

Go

Technical Skills

backend developmenterror handlingfile handling